Produced by Dong Woo Animation in Korea, the series is written by Tetsuo Yasumi, best known as the head writer of the anime adaptation of Happy Happy Clover with Japanese producer Mitsuko Ohya of Duel Masters in charge of production.
An official Japanese dubbed version aired in Japan on TV Tokyo on February 5, 2012, to March 25, 2012, replacing Bakugan Battle Brawlers: Gundalian Invaders in its initial time slot.
The series itself is based on the Sega Toys adaptation of the toyline in both Japan and Korea, which differs greatly from the American version by Spin Master.
Korean pop group Rainbow also contributed to the anime's production as they sang both the opening and ending themes.
In January 2012, the series was announced to depart on the NoriNori♪Nori Suta block and have its official TV premiere on February 5, 2012, until March 25, 2012.
